我正在寻找一种TrueCrypt替代方案,它具有以编程方式访问文件的API。有人知道解决方案吗?
API应支持文件的列出、创建、更改和删除。
发布于 2012-05-05 05:14:27
Diskcryptor没有API,但它是GPL。
如果可以的话,我相信您所要求的是一个抽象的文件系统库。我知道您想加载一个TrueCrypt或类似的容器并列出它的内容。当它打开时,这样的容器只是表示扇区的原始字节。在加密之上,这样的api将只能看到原始扇区,并且它必须使用相应的扇区级别API来理解它们。
你可以用另一种方式来看待这个问题。您如何编写一个程序,例如zip,可以在zip文件中显示这样的信息,如果您愿意的话,这是一个非常常见的容器。

所以你要找的API需要满足两个条件:
不久前,我问过自己同样的问题,我在网上搜寻答案,这个答案就是我到目前为止找到的答案的总和。我希望你能找到一个有效的答案,即使它是不可操作的。
无论如何,现在还不是;)
发布于 2010-12-14 04:21:25
如果您计划创建新软件,我们的SolFS OS Edition可能就是您正在寻找的。它可以在Windows,MacOS X,Linux和FreeBSD上使用。
发布于 2018-09-24 20:38:31
集成加密的Java文件系统提供程序:https://github.com/cryptomator/cryptofs
https://stackoverflow.com/questions/4432816
复制相似问题